First Officer
Job Overview
This position supports the aircraft Captain in ensuring the safe and timely operation of the aircraft, while fulfilling other aircraft management duties.
Essential Duties
- Collaborates with the Captain in flight planning, utilizing comprehensive weather information and reports in accordance with Company policies, procedures, and Federal Aviation Regulations (FARs).
- Assesses aircraft airworthiness in accordance with FARs and Company policies and procedures, completing all pre-flight inspections.
- In conjunction with the Captain, ensures proper flight planning and fuel management to maintain a safe and compliant flight.
- Operates the aircraft safely, proficiently, and effectively throughout the assigned duty period, following the Captain's instructions, FARs, and Company policies and procedures.
- Possesses a thorough understanding of aircraft equipment, FARs governing its operation, manuals, policies, procedures, and other pertinent instructions.
- Informs the crew and passengers of turbulent weather conditions or any other operational factors affecting the flight.
- Completes the load manifest for each flight.
- Contributes to a reliable and on-time operation by assisting the Captain in meeting all report times, departure times, and minimum turn times.
- While at the terminal, assists with and ensures proper handling of aircraft, passengers, baggage, and cargo.
- Maintains regular and reliable attendance adhering to Company procedures and practices.
- Presents a professional appearance, adhering to the Company uniform dress code.
- Conducts oneself professionally at all times while on duty and observes the Rules of Conduct for all associates as outlined in the Flight Operations Manual, Associate Handbook, and other related policies and procedures.
- Engages in professional training to enhance performance and abilities.
- Performs other duties as assigned by the Company and the Captain.
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
- High School diploma or GED.
- Must meet the minimum requirements for an ATP or RATP certificate.
- ATP written is preferred.
- Must meet the current interview and hiring minimum age and flight hours requirements set by the FAA and Company.
If a candidate meets the interview minimums, but not the hiring minimums, they will be eligible for hire upon successful completion of the interview process if they:
- Meet the Hiring Minimums within six months of the interview date.
- Have no certificate action since the date of the interview.
- Have no misdemeanors or felonies since the interview date.
- Accept a class date within six months of the interview date.
